Course Overview

This advanced course is tailored for professionals working with electrical systems, focusing on the in-depth use of ETAP software for system modeling, analysis, and troubleshooting. It equips engineers and analysts with the practical know-how to simulate and interpret complex electrical behaviors using real-world scenarios. The course enhances decision-making and technical accuracy in electrical network planning and optimization.

Course Objective

  • Utilize ETAP software proficiently for electrical system modeling and analysis
  • Conduct detailed short circuit, load flow, harmonic, and stability analyses
  • Design and assess protection schemes with relay coordination
  • Diagnose and resolve system performance issues using ETAP simulations
  • Apply learned techniques in practical case studies and engineering challenges

Course Outline

1. Introduction to ETAP Software

  • Overview of ETAP Capabilities
  • Basic Interface and Features
  • Setting Up Projects in ETAP

2. Power System Modeling with ETAP

  • Creating Electrical Models
  • Component Selection and Configuration
  • Modeling Different Electrical Systems

3. Load Flow Analysis

  • Performing Load Flow Studies
  • Analyzing System Performance
  • Optimization Techniques for Load Flow

4. Short Circuit Analysis

  • Short Circuit Calculation Methods
  • Identifying Fault Conditions
  • Impact Analysis of Short Circuits

5. Protection and Coordination

  • Designing Protection Schemes
  • Relay Coordination Studies
  • Ensuring System Safety and Reliability

6. Transient and Stability Analysis

  • Transient Analysis Techniques
  • System Stability Studies
  • Mitigating Transient Effects

7. Harmonic Analysis and Mitigation

  • Harmonic Sources and Effects
  • Conducting Harmonic Studies
  • Strategies for Harmonic Mitigation

8. Practical Applications and Case Studies

  • Real-World Applications using ETAP
  • Challenges and Solutions in Electrical Analysis
  • Best Practices and Lessons Learned
